Exactly. I want my car to be bit more throaty. I think the headers will do that. But, I also want it to be quiet enough on a long trip that the drone doesn't drive me crazy. I just want to hear it a bit more when I step on it. I also want the added HP the headers and tune will give me. One other reason I'm putting the Borla exhaust on is that I really don't like the look of the stock mufflers. The Borla also has much nicer tips. So, some of this work is for performance, some sound, and some cosmetic. I hope it works!
